**Ticket: Config drift blocking zero-downtime migrations**

For the sync: the Quillbase staging replica drifted from prod, so our expand-contract schema migration dry runs are meaningless. Two columns exist only in staging; lock timeouts differ too. We need both environments pinned before Thursday's cut. Proposed canonical settings for the migration runner are listed below.

service settings:
PRAWYN_PIN=9848
PRAWYN_METRICS_HOST=metrics.prawyn.lumicworks.corp
PRAWYN_LOG_LEVEL=warn
PRAWYN_TENANT=pelius

Subject: Inkwell markdown pipeline 5.1 deployed

On-call: the Inkwell rendering pipeline is now on 5.1 in production. Changes: sanitizer runs before the table parser, footnote rendering is cached per document, and the fallback plain-text path no longer strips headings. If render latency alarms fire, roll back via the standard script — it handles cache invalidation. Known issue: nested blockquotes over six levels render flat. The deployment trace token follows.

build token for hawep-kageg: htk14_558814e2114cc7

Hey Priya,

Handing off the dark-mode work on the Quillbrook admin dashboard before I'm out. The toggle itself is done; what's left is the theme service that persists user preference server-side. Nothing scary security-wise — it's a single authenticated endpoint, no PII beyond the pref flag. Marek reviewed the CSS injection angle already and signed off. For your review, the theme service runs with the following settings.

config for tafof-tafog:
ulaath:
  log_level: warn
  metrics_host: metrics.ulaath.tolvaqlabs.internal
  pin: 4644
  pool_size: 8

Handing the Fernhollow tile cache over to support. Evictions spiked last week because the warm-path prefetcher was double-counting zoom-level 14 tiles; that's patched, but watch hit ratio after any map style release. Restarting the cache layer is safe and takes about two minutes. If tiles render stale, check that each node is running with the configuration values shown here.

service settings:
[casax]
port = 6379
team = rusir
host = casax.zemvarhq.corp
region = outer-4
access_code = ac_9808ce
timeout_ms = 1500